In this issue, Gardner Fox and Harry Lampert introduced Jay Garrick. Unlike modern versions who get their power from the Speed Force, Jay gained his abilities by inhaling "hard water" vapors in a laboratory accident. Wearing his iconic winged Mercury helmet, he became the first person to carry the mantle of the Flash.
